What companies run services between Livermore, CA, USA and Sacramento, CA, USA?

You can take a bus from Livermore Amtrak Bus Stop to Sacramento via Stockton in around 3h 45m. Alternatively, Amtrak operates a train from Fremont to Sacramento every 4 hours. Tickets cost $35–75 and the journey takes 2h 42m.
